*****First - we need JEGGINGS
NY Daily News writer Issie Lapowsky test drove 3 pairs of jeggings around NYC and this is what she found: C&C California wins out on the most comfortable and flattering jeggings. Of course, they're also the most expensive of the three at $128.

For instance, you could take Gap's Faded Gray wash Legging-Jeans (thank you Gap!)--
And match them with these Giuseppe Zanotti Denim Boxer Boots.
For a streetstyle example of the Legging-Boot Combo check out this lady waiting for the train. She's looking at my business card as I take pictures....Is she wearing yellow nail polish? Cool, it matches the tint in this photo.
She's applying the same concept to American Apparel's Shiny Leggings.
The key is to try and match them perfectly. The transition should be so flawless that it seems from afar that the boots and the leggings are one piece. It might be a little time consuming and expensive to find the perfect boots to match the jeggings or vice versa but TRUST -
